Project: Edit-Distance Based Algorithms for Shape-Based Retrieval of Images


Philip Klein (Computer Science), Benjamin Kimia and Thomas Sebastian (Engineering)


Papers


Goal: Enable shape-based retrieval from an image database

Question: How to measure similarity of shapes?
Answer: Compare their skeletons (labeled graphs)
\psfig{figure=figs/orig1.ps, height=3in} \psfig{figure=figs/orig2.ps, height=3in}


What metric to use? Earlier work by Kimia:
distance between labeled graphs = value of a quadratic integer program.
Disadvantages:


Our Approach - Edit Distance

\psfig{figure=figs/bonefish_original_boundary.ps,height=6.2cm} \psfig{figure=figs/bonefish_to_herring_editop1.ps,height=6.2cm} \psfig{figure=figs/attempt.ps,height=6.2cm} \psfig{figure=figs/herring_to_bonefish_editop3.ps,height=6.2cm} \psfig{figure=figs/herring_to_bonefish_editop2.ps,height=6.2cm} \psfig{figure=figs/herring_to_bonefish_editop1.ps,height=6.2cm} \psfig{figure=figs/herring_original_boundary.ps,height=6.2cm}


Ongoing research


Philip Klein
2000-03-02